I don't think so. As far as I'm aware, MIDI program change commands can only be assigned to individual instruments/layers. That's because the program change command is associated with a particular MIDI channel - not the whole instrument.harmony gardens wrote:Is it possible to use a program change to load a new combination?
However, depending on your host, you can use an instrument preset to store the combi, and use your host's automation to load that preset.
More memory means you can load larger instruments, and more of them. I've got a gig of RAM, and I've never come close to running out.harmony gardens wrote:IOne more question,,, will we benefit from more memory to load larger combinations?

To install the sounds you simply insert the DVD into your drive and drag and drop the sounds to wherever you want. If you want to use it instantly in ST2 with your other ST2 sounds then drag it into your ST2Instruments folder.weaverid wrote:How do I install just the sounds from the DVD? If the DVD is whirring and not working in your drive then email shipping@esoundz.com to see if you could get a replacement. There are two types of DVDs that we have so perhaps they can send you the other type to see if THAT works better for your drive. Or you can try again a few times to see if your drive is just acting up (which I've experienced... sometimes restarting helps too).
